On strongly Hausdorff flows
Fundamenta Mathematicae, Tome 149 (1996) no. 2, pp. 167-170
A flow of an open manifold is very complicated even if its orbit space is Hausdorff. In this paper, we define the strongly Hausdorff flows and consider their dynamical properties in terms of the orbit spaces. By making use of this characterization, we finally classify all the strongly Hausdorff $C^1$-flows.
